Turns out Vladimir Tarasenko’s absence will be brief.
The Blues sniper, who sat out Saturday’s game against Minnesota with a lower-body injury, will be back in the lineup for tomorrow’s game against the Kings (8:30 p.m., NBCSN).
Tarasenko was hurt in a win over the Ducks last week, but managed to finish that game before sitting out the Wild tilt. The Blues didn’t seem overly concerned with Tarasenko’s health; on Saturday, head coach Ken Hitchcock joked that the lower-body ailment would keep the Russian out for “the month of October.”
Saturday, of course, was Oct. 31.
Tarasenko is off to a terrific start this season, leading the 8-2-1 Blues with six goals and 10 points. His production is a big reason the club’s been able to withstand the losses of injured forwards Paul Stastny, Patrik Berglund and Jaden Schwartz.
